Question 2 of 5

A nurse is caring for a client who is 1 day postoperative following a transsphenoidal hypophysectomy. While assessing the client, the nurse notes a large area of clear drainage seeping from the nasal packing. Which of the following should be the nurse's initial action?

Correct Answer: B

Rationale: Clear nasal drainage post-hypophysectomy may indicate a CSF leak; checking for glucose helps confirm this, as CSF contains glucose.

Question 4 of 5

The primary healthcare provider prescribes a cough syrup of 0.4 g every 4 hours. The dosage strength of the syrup is 100 mg/5 mL. The medication bottle contains a measuring spoon that measures in teaspoons and tablespoons. How many teaspoons will the nurse instruct the client to take?

Correct Answer: 4 tsp

Rationale: 0.4 g = 400 mg; 400 mg ÷ (100 mg/5 mL) = 20 mL; 20 mL × 0.2 tsp/mL = 4 tsp, confirming the correct calculation.
